Feta Cheese Or Tuna Sweet-Potato Jackets
- 4 small sweet potatoes (about 200g each)
- 6 1/2 ounces tuna in water, drained or 6 1/2 ounces crumbled feta cheese
- 1/2 medium red onion, finely sliced
- 1 small red chile, deseeded and chopped (if you choose, use some seeds)
- 1 lime, juice of
- 6 tablespoons Greek yogurt
- 1/4 cup coriander leaves or 1/4 cup chopped flat leaf parsley
- Scrub the sweet potatoes and prick all over with a fork.
- Place on a microwaveable plate and cook on High for 18-20 mins, or until tender.
- Split in half and place each one, cut-side up, on a serving plate.
- Spread the crumbled feta cheese or flake the drained tuna with a fork and divide between the sweet potatoes.
- Top with the red onion and chilli, then squeeze over the lime juice.
- Top with a dollop of yogurt and scatter over the coriander or parsley, to serve.
